EN 10020 is a critical European Standard with the full title "Definition and classification of grades of steel." It serves as the foundational document that defines, once and for all, what the term "steel" actually means and provides a systematic way to classify the thousands of different steel grades available on the European market.

Stainless steels are not subdivided further into quality and special grades within EN 10020 itself, as the various categories of stainless steel (austenitic, ferritic, martensitic, duplex, etc.) are defined in other product standards.
